    Illustrative describes something - usually an example, a story, or a case - that helps explain or make an idea clearer. You'll meet this word mostly in formal, academic, or explanatory writing, where a teacher or writer wants to show a point using a specific example.

    說明性的、用來舉例說明的(常見於正式/學術寫作)

組成illustrate ('to explain something using examples, pictures, or clear description') + -ive ('serving to'). Illustrative means serving to illustrate, or make clear.

同家族的字

  • illustratethe base verb this comes from
  • illustrationshares 'illustrate' - a picture or example that explains something

illustrativeadj/ɪˈlʌs.tɹə.tɪv/

  • 1

    Demonstrative, exemplative, showing an example or demonstrating.

    • This latest incident is illustrative of his continued bad behavior.
